Papyrus Paper (Pre-Industrial Age) (1 gen 2900 anni a. C. – 1 gen 1700 anni)
Descrizione:
Papyrus is a type of paper-like material that was produced from the pith of the Cyperus papyrus plant, a tall reed-like plant native to the Nile Delta in Egypt. The ancient Egyptians and other civilizations in the Mediterranean region used papyrus as a writing and drawing surface for thousands of years.
